Rancho Santa Margarita Catholic H.S. (Rancho Santa Margarita, CA)

Ht: 6-foot-3
Wt: 205 lbs
40: 4.65 secs

Rivals rating: 3*-5.7rr; #30 S
Scout rating: 3*; #38 OLB
ESPN rating: 3*-77 grade; #76 ATH
247s rating: 3*-87 rating; #37 S

Reported Offers: COLORADO, Arizona State, Cal, Duke, Oregon, Oregon State, Washington, Washington State

O'Brien had a tremendous junior season for Rancho Santa Margarita and played a large role in the school winning a state title. Overall, he finished with 92 tackles and 8 INTs at safety, earning him All-Trinity League and All-Orange County honors. For those that may not know, the Trinity League is arguably the toughest league in California.

“I got my first offer from Colorado,” O’Brien said. “They actually offered me as a linebacker and feel I have the frame to grow in to the position. I talked with Brian Cabral on Sunday and when he told me they were offering, it was such a good feeling.

“This is my first offer and to have it come from Colorado is incredible. Both my dad and my uncle played at Colorado and growing up, I always rooted for the Buffs."
